With "Parklife" was published in 1994, the third studio album by Blur, and can be considered confidently as their total stimmgstes and qualitatively best album. The sequel to "Modern Life is Rubbish" established the band around Damon Albarn finally at the top of the British music scene and drove the Britpop boom to the extreme. The album was on the island an absolute bestseller and remained well over a year in the "Top 40".
Even in the rather hesitant Continental Europe the first single "Girls and Boys" reached many top tenth
The album is characteristic of the early stages of Blur - biting and sarcastic lyrics with lots of social criticism, considering the human daily life and the associated fates. A great CD that I like to hear from time to time. Sound of Youth, you know?
Outstanding are next "Girls and Boys", the bittersweet "To The End" and the great lyrics written "End of a Century" - and last but not least the oblique and super-ironic "Parklife".
Unlike some younger work of the band, which I would not wholeheartedly recommend genre fans, this CD is a real "must".
